A Multidisciplinary Investigation of the Intermediate Depths of the Atlantic Ocean: AAIW delta^13C Variability During the Younger Dryas and Lithoherms in the Straits of Florida

Brookshire, Brian 2010 December 1900 (has links)
A transect of cores ranging from 798 m to 1585 m water depth in the South Atlantic Ocean document the relative intermediate water mass nutrient geometry and stable isotopic variability of AAIW during the Younger Dryas cooling event. The data reveal concurrent delta^13 C and delta^18 O excursions of 0.59 ppt and 0.37 ppt within the core of Antarctic Intermediate Water (AAIW) centered at 11,381 calendar years before present based on radiometric age control. A portion of the delta^1 3C variability (0.22 ppt) can be explained by a shift in thermodynamic equilibrium concurrent with a drop in temperature of 1.8°C at the locus of AAIW formation. The remaining 0.37 ppt increase in delta^13 C most likely resulted from increased wind velocities, and a greater coupling between the ocean and the atmosphere at the locus of AAIW formation (increased efficiency of the thermodynamic process). Deepwater coral mounds are aggregates of corals, other organisms, their skeletal remains, and sediments that occur on the seafloor of the world’s oceans. In the Straits of Florida, these features have been referred to as lithoherms. We use digital, side-scan sonar data collected from the submarine NR-1 from an 10.9 km^2 area at ~650 m water depth to characterize quantitatively aspects of the morphology of 216. Their lengths, widths, heights, areas, orientations and concentration on the seafloor have been determined. Analysis indicates that the outlines of relatively small to medium sized lithoherms can be effectively described with a piriform function. This shape is less applicable to the largest lithoherms because they are aggregates of smaller lithoherms. Nearly all of the lithoherms studied have axes parallel to the northward flowing Florida Current, and the heads of 80 percent of these features face into the current. The shape and orientation of the lithoherms, and evidence of megaripples and scouring in the sonar data suggest that these features are formed by a unidirectional current. Following an extensive investigation of over 200 lithoherms via side-scan sonar imagery and direct observation, we have developed a qualitative model for the formation of the lithoherm type of deep-water coral mounds in the Straits of Florida. Lithoherm formation can be characterized by four main stages of development: nucleating, juvenile, mature singular, and fused. Fused lithoherms can form via transverse and/or longitudinal accretion, however, transverse accretion at the head of the mound is likely the most efficient mechanism. A comparison of lithoherm spatial relationship to local bathymetry agrees with previous observations of deep-water coral mound formations along the levied margins of density flow scour channels.

Formalising stress in Senćoten

Leonard, Janet 25 January 2010 (has links)
The purpose of this thesis is to contribute to our understanding of how stress is assigned in SENCOTEN (a dialect of North Straits Salish). The stress system of the Salish languages has been traditionally thought of as being highly morpho-lexical. Montler (1986: 23) states that in SENCOTEN, roots and affixes are lexically specified for their stress properties. He claims that these roots and affixes are in a hierarchical relationship and compete with each other for stress assignment. However, in this thesis, I show that there is much less morpho-lexical stress in SENCOTEN than previously thought. The stress pattern of a high number of polymorphemic words, namely those that contain lexical suffixes, can be accounted for without resorting to a morphological hierarchy of stress. Instead, using an Optimality Theory analysis inspired by the work of Dyck (2004) and Kiyota (2003), I show that it is the weight distinction between full vowels and schwa that determines where stress will be assigned. In addition, I am able to show that metrical feet are grouped into trochees and that these trochaic feet are aligned to the right edge of the word.

Senćoten resultive construction

Turner, Claire Kelly 11 February 2010 (has links)
The resultive and actual (imperfective) aspects in SENCOTEN, a dialect of North Straits Salish, have been previously considered to contain two separate actual and resultive morphemes (Montler 1986). In contrast, it is argued here that the SENOTEN resultive construction is a complex construction, built on an actual base by prefixation of stative [s-]. Both morphophonological evidence and morphosyntactic evidence for this claim are considered: resultives and actuals exhibit the same non-concatenative allomorphy, and they appear to be in complementary distribution with respect to argument structure. This thesis also considers the semantic aspectual properties of resultives, and suggests that the morphologically complex resultive is semantically compositional: it contains a [durative] feature contributed by the actual morpheme and a [static] feature contributed by the stative prefix.

Environmental Controls on Cold-Water Coral Mound Distribution, Morphology, and Development in the Straits of Florida

Simoes Correa, Thiago Barreto 05 February 2012 (has links)
Scleractinian cold-water corals are widely distributed in seaways and basins of the North Atlantic Ocean, including the Straits of Florida. These corals can form extensive biogenic mounds, which are biodiversity hotspots in the deep ocean. The processes that lead to the genesis of such cold-water coral mounds and control their distribution and morphology are poorly understood. This work uses an innovative mapping approach that combines 130 km2 of high resolution geophysical and oceanographic data collected using an Autonomous Underwater Vehicle (AUV) from five cold-water coral habitats in the Straits of Florida. These AUV data, together with ground-truthing observations from eleven submersible dives, are used to investigate fine-scale mound parameters and their relationships with environmental factors. Based on these datasets, automated methods are developed for extracting and analyzing mound morphometrics and coral cover. These analyses reveal that mound density is 14 mound/km2 for the three surveyed sites on the toe-of-slope of Great Bahama Bank (GBB); this density is higher than previously documented (0.3 mound/km2) in nearby mound fields. Morphometric analyses further indicate that mounds vary significantly in size, from a meter to up to 110 m in relief, and 81 to 600,000 m2 in footprint area. In addition to individual mounds, cold-water corals also develop in some areas as elongated low-relief ridges that are up to 25 m high and 2000 m long. These ridges cover approximately 60 and 70% of the mapped seafloor from the sites at the center of the Straits and at the base of the Miami Terrace, respectively. Morphometrics and current data analyses across the five surveyed fields indicate that mounds and ridges are not in alignment with the dominant current directions. These findings contradict previous studies that described streamlined mounds parallel to the northward Florida Current. In contrast, this study shows that the sites dominated by coral ridges are influenced by unidirectional flowing current, whereas the mounds on the GBB slope are influenced by tidal current regime. The GBB mounds also experience higher sedimentation rates relative to the sites away from the GBB slope. Sub-surface data document partially or completely buried mounds on the GBB sites. The sediments burying mounds are off-bank material transported downslope by mass gravity flow. Mass gravity transport creates complex slope architecture on the toe-of-slope of GBB, with canyons, slump scars, and gravity flow deposits. Cold-water corals use all three of these features as location for colonization. Coral mounds growing on such pre-existing topography keep up with off-bank sedimentation. In contrast, away from the GBB slope, off-bank sedimentation is absent and coral ridges grow independently of antecedent topography. In the sediment-starved Miami Terrace site, coral ridge initiation is related to a cemented mid-Miocene unconformity. In the center of the Straits, coral ridges and knobs develop over an unconsolidated sand sheet at the tail of the Pourtales drift. Coral features at the Miami Terrace and center of the Straits have intricate morphologies, including waveform and chevron-like ridges, which result from asymmetrical coral growth. Dense coral frameworks and living coral colonies grow preferentially on the current-facing ridge sides in order to optimize food particle capture, whereas coral rubble and mud-sized sediments accumulate in the ridge leesides. Finally, this study provides a method using solely acoustic data for discriminating habitats in which cold-water corals are actively growing. Results from this method can guide future research on and management of cold-water coral ecosystems. Taken together, spatial quantitative analyses of the large-scale, high-resolution integrated surveys indicate that cold-water coral habitats in the Straits of Florida: (1) are significantly more diverse and abundant than previously thought, and (2) can be influenced in their distribution and development by current regime, sedimentation, and/or antecedent topography.

A human history of Tl’chés, 1860-1973

Forest-Hammond, Elise Gabrielle 04 May 2020 (has links)
This thesis represents a human history of Tl’chés (Discovery and Chatham Islands) roughly between the mid-19th and mid-20th centuries. It presents Songhees and Settler life on the archipelago, as well as the dispossession of Songhees lands. Detailing processes of colonialism, as well as Songhees resistance to it, this thesis represents a microcosm of colonialism as it unfolded in the lands now called British Columbia. / Graduate

China and Central Asia's Transnational Concerns Require Multilateral Solutions

Tobin, Blake 01 December 2014 (has links)
After seven decades of regional domination, the sudden collapse of the Soviet Union in 1991 put the whole continent in a state of political and economic uncertainty. The sudden absence of a strong, yet generally predictable hegemon initiated an intense debate centered on whether or not the rise of China posed a grave threat to the region or whether it would bring stability and cohesion to the region. After 23 years of observation, it is now safe to presume that China does not pose a military threat to the region. Simply because China does not have expansionist or aggressive political or economic aims does not mean that there should be no cause for concern. China does possess persistent political, economic, and security concerns that, despite the nation's best efforts, has not been able to solve. Domestically, examples of these concerns are illegal smuggling, weapons and human trafficking, illegal narcotics, organized crime, Islamic fundamentalism, ethnic nationalism, and Islamic militancy. Internationally, China has had a hard time, not only dealing with the aforementioned list, but also with piracy, ethnic unrest, anti-Chinese sentiment, corruption, and illegal port activities. The reason the solution to these problems remains elusive is the fact that they all share a common element. The element is that they are all transnational in nature; the events themselves, not fully encapsulated within the borders of just one nation-state. This makes them extremely difficult for a single nation-state to be able to effectively deal with them. It happens that Central Asian nations and littoral nations of Malaysia, Indonesia, and Singapore are also afflicted with many of the same issues. This fact is why it will take a comprehensive and coordinated effort in order to effectively deal with the underlying causes which contribute to these problems before any noticeable effect will take place. These efforts, or transnational solutions, are the most effective way to deal with transnational concerns. Research, observations, and the case studies demonstrate that many of the most pressing transnational concerns have similar underlying factors. Income inequality, government repression, and lack of economic opportunity are a few of the most prevalent factors. The obstacles these factors cause are not insurmountable. However each one of these problems require a concentrated and coordinated effort and the cooperation of multiple nation-states. International Organizations, such as the Shanghai Cooperation Organization, are effective mediums in which to accomplish this. What is repeatedly observed is that transnational problems are best solved using transnational solutions.

A phonetic investigation of vowel variation in Lekwungen

Nolan, Tess 04 May 2017 (has links)
This thesis conducted the first acoustic analysis on Lekwungen (aka Songhees, Songish) (Central Salish). It studied the acoustic correlates of stress on vowels and the effects of consonantal coarticulatory effects on vowel quality. The goals of the thesis were to provide useful and usable materials and information to Lekwungen language revitalisation efforts and to provide an acoustic study of Lekwungen vowels to expand knowledge of Salishan languages and linguistics. Duration, mean pitch, and mean amplitude were measured on vowels in various stress environments. Findings showed that there is a three-way contrast between vowels in terms of duration and only a two-way contrast in terms of pitch and amplitude. F1, F2, and F3 were measured at vowel onset (5%), midpoint (50%), and offset (95%), as well as a mean (5%-95%), in CVC sequences for four vowels: /i/, /e/, /a/, and /ə/. Out of five places of articulation of consonants in Lekwungen (alveolar, palatal, labio-velar, uvular, glottal), uvular and glottal had the most persistent effects on F1, F2, and F3 of all vowels. Of the vowels, unstressed /ə/ was the most persistently affected by all consonants. Several effects on perception were also preliminarily documented, but future work is needed to see how persistence in acoustic effects is correlated with perception. This thesis provides information and useful tips to help learners and teachers in writing and perceiving Lekwungen and for learners learning Lekwungen pronunciation, as a part of language revitalisation efforts. It also contributes to the growing body of acoustic phonetic work on Salishan languages, especially on vowels. / Graduate / 0290

A hydrokinetic resource assessment of the Florida Current

Unknown Date (has links)
The Straits of Florida has been noted as a potential location for extraction of the kydrokinetic energy of the Florida Current, in view of the strength of the current and its proximity to the shore. ... This research explores the Florida Current as a potential renewable energy source. By utilizing historical data, in situ observations of the Florida Current, and computer model data, the hydrokinetic resource of the Florida Current is characterized both spatially and temporally. Subsequently, based on the geographic variability of the hydrokinetic power and other factors that impact the economy of a hydrokinetic turbine array installation, the ideal locations for turbine array installation within the Florida Current are identified.... Additionally, an interactive tool has been developed in which array parameters are input - including installation location, turbine diameter, turbine cut-in speed, etc. - and array extraction estimates, ideal installation position, and water depth at the installation points are output. As ocean model data is prominently used in this research, a discussion about the limitations of the ocean model data and a method for overcoming these limitations are described. Globally, the distribution of hydrokinetic power intensity is evaluated to identify other currents that have a high hydrokinetic resource. / by Alana E. Speak Good English Movement in Singapore : Reactions in Social and Traditional Media

Suhonen, Lari-Valtteri January 2011 (has links)
The first Speak Good English Movement, SGEM, took place in 2000, and has been organized annually ever since. Speaking a “standard” form of English is considered to bring increased personal power. However, the SGEM wants the Singaporeans to use “standard” English in their private life as well. A decade after the beginning of the campaign, a Speak Good Singlish Movement was started. Based on studies of language and identity, it is understandable why some Singaporeans might feel the SGEM threatens their identity. However, the reactions towards the campaign are mainly positive. For the purposes of this analysis, Twitter messages, Facebook pages, and newspaper articles from The Straits Times were collected. The SGEM has hailed both direct and indirect praise and criticism in both social and traditional media: Five newspaper articles praise the campaign while five criticize it; the results are nine and seven respectively for social media. This thesis looks at reactions towards the SGEM in both social and traditional media, analyzes how these reactions might relate to the ideas of the power of language, its variety and the relation of language and identity.
